Psychology QUESTION #9913
Question 749
Which of the following could be attributed to Tolman's research?
  • Discovery of the law of effect
  • The concept of cognitive mapโœ”๏ธ
  • The negative effect of punishment
  • The role of classical conditioning in phobic disorders
Correct Answer Logic:
Tolman's most notable contribution was the cognitive map concept โ€” demonstrated through latent learning experiments showing rats form internal mental representations of mazes, challenging pure stimulus-response behaviourism.

Civil Procedure QUESTION #5663
Question 750
In a diversity case, a plaintiff serves a corporation by delivering the summons and complaint to a 'managing agent' at the corporation's headquarters. The corporation argues service was improper because the agent was not 'authorized by law' to receive service. Which is the most accurate statement under Rule 4(h)?
  • Service is only valid if the agent is specifically authorized by a state statute.
  • Service is valid if the individual is a managing or general agent, regardless of whether they are 'authorized by law'.โœ”๏ธ
  • Service must be made on the CEO or Chief Executive Officer specifically.
  • Service is invalid unless a copy is also mailed to the defendant's principal place of business.
Correct Answer Logic:
Rule 4(h)(1)(B) allows service on a domestic or foreign corporation by delivering a copy of the summons and complaint to an officer, a managing or general agent, or any other agent authorized by appointment or by law.

Physics QUESTION #7034
Question 752
A student records the length of a rod as $3.50 \text{ cm}$. Identify the instrument used for this measurement based on its precision.
  • A screw gauge with a pitch of $1 \text{ mm}$ and $100$ circular scale divisions
  • A screw gauge with a pitch of $1 \text{ mm}$ and $50$ circular scale divisions
  • A standard metre scale
  • A vernier calliper where $10$ divisions of the vernier scale coincide with $9$ main scale divisions (main scale has $10 \text{ divisions per cm}$)โœ”๏ธ
Correct Answer Logic:

The recorded value $3.50 \text{ cm}$ has a precision of $0.01 \text{ cm}$. We must find an instrument with a least count (LC) of $0.01 \text{ cm}$.

  • Option A: $LC = \frac{1 \text{ mm}}{100} = 0.01 \text{ mm} = 0.001 \text{ cm}$
  • Option B: $LC = \frac{1 \text{ mm}}{50} = 0.02 \text{ mm} = 0.002 \text{ cm}$
  • Option C: $LC = 0.1 \text{ cm}$
  • Option D: $1 \text{ MSD} = \frac{1 \text{ cm}}{10} = 0.1 \text{ cm}$. Since $10 \text{ VSD} = 9 \text{ MSD}$, $1 \text{ VSD} = 0.9 \text{ MSD}$. $LC = 1 \text{ MSD} - 1 \text{ VSD} = 0.1 \text{ MSD} = 0.01 \text{ cm}$.

Thus, Option D matches the required precision.

Psychology QUESTION #9905
Question 753
In Thurston's method of attitude scaling, the key factor is the use of:
  • Numbers
  • Judgesโœ”๏ธ
  • Reinforcement
  • Positive and negative items
Correct Answer Logic:
In Thurston's equal-appearing interval method, the critical element is a panel of judges who evaluate attitude statements and place them on an 11-point scale from unfavourable to favourable. Median judge ratings determine each item's scale value.
